Transaction 53aa5c7c596a7909be1afceb6086075cdda832c0b713c3615141f50705df4b88

2 Input
2 Outputs
  • 53aa5c7c596a7909be1afceb6086075cdda832c0b713c3615141f50705df4b88:0
  • value  189836
    address  1Dz7amBzW6f4UX86gmTtLhJDURXPQcK4Fc
  • 53aa5c7c596a7909be1afceb6086075cdda832c0b713c3615141f50705df4b88:1
  • value  4089690
    address  33hmyRvxhBy6VadiWadYgataTNDW5JebWa